Cybersecurity Survival Guide for Businesses of Any Size

No matter the size of your business, cybersecurity should be a priority. This seminar will break down the essential topics every organization needs to know — including the end of life for Microsoft Server, Desktop, and Office products, as well as what that means for your business.
We’ll also highlight practical security updates and strategies that can make a real difference, especially for small and mid-sized businesses without a full in-house I.T. team.
Protecting your data, your customers, and your reputation has never been more important. Don’t miss this chance to learn how to stay ahead of the curve. Your business deserves the tools to stay secure.


Featured speaker:
Dan Durkee, Director of Network Services for Twotrees Technology

Dan Durkee is the Director of Network Services for Twotrees (formerly Connecting Point). Dan aspires to live in a world where all the passwords are strong, ransomware is held in check, and everyone has GB fiber internet service at their home and business. He has passed over 40 IT certification tests including national certification tests by Ruckus, Cisco, HP, Microsoft, Novell, Symantec, Altiris, Promethean, Kaseya, and CompTIA. He has been a hockey announcer and public speaker since 1988.

Dan’s security certifications include CompTIA Security+, Criminal Justice Information Services (CJIS) – LASO Officer (Local Agency Security Officer), CJIS – Level 4 Security Awareness Training, Florida International University – Cybersecurity Leadership and Strategy, Florida International University – CISSP Level 1: Intro to Concepts, Techniques and Domains.

Join us for a fun-filled day of golf and community at the YMCA Golf Scramble! The Altru Family YMCA is hosting its annual Golf Tournament on Thursday, September 4, 2025 at King’s Walk Golf Course. The event supports the YMCA Partner of Youth financial scholarship program. The 4-person team, 18-hole scramble will begin with lunch and registration at 11:00 am followed by a 12:00 noon shotgun start. Cost is $125/player or $500/team. The tournament includes cart service, lunch, dinner, door prizes, and course games like longest drive, longest putt, closest to the pin, and the $1,000 putt contest. Sponsorships are available! **About the Women's Fund**
Established in 2002 by 20 area women, the Women’s Fund is a component fund of the Community Foundation of Grand Forks, East Grand Forks & Region that promotes regional programs to inspire, empower, and invest in women and girls. It also allows for tax-deductible gifts of all sizes to collectively make an even greater difference in the communities of Grand Forks, Walsh, and Polk Counties.

On 10 September, the IEEE-USA Innovation, Workforce, and Research Conference (IWRC) will bring together stakeholders from industry, government, and academia for an AI and Autonomy Summit at the University of North Dakota. The Grand Forks region is a global leader in unmanned and autonomous systems research, application and policy development. At IWRC, we will meet, network, learn, and discuss federal and state technology initiatives related to artificial intelligence and autonomy, and other government programs that promote innovation and small business in the upper midwest. Bring any unused or expired medications (including pills, creams, inhalers, patches, liquids and even pet meds) in their original container to the drop-off event to have them properly disposed of. Medications can be OTC or prescription. Labels can be left on the medications as they will simply be incinerated. For more information, call Safe Kids Grand Forks at 701.780.1489.

On September 25, the Longest Table welcomes 700 residents to sit down for a free meal in a welcoming environment with people they may not know, to foster stronger connections and exchange ideas.

Our theme in 2025 will collaboratively explore the interconnections between education and industry and their impact on the community’s well-being and future. The importance of connection, discussion, relationships, and community have never been more important.

The Longest Table will provide space for residents to exchange stories and share ideas about what we can do as a community to ensure that educational programs prepare individuals for meaningful careers, the economy supports local livelihoods, and industries are responsive to community needs..
